Transaction f21332940a49dd60789bc5c947935e59e0a4ea6c3e97785257b950c65afadf39
1 Input
2 Outputs
- f21332940a49dd60789bc5c947935e59e0a4ea6c3e97785257b950c65afadf39:0
- f21332940a49dd60789bc5c947935e59e0a4ea6c3e97785257b950c65afadf39:1
value 36514467
address 1GGhu4fstVTnUwAzJdyDGBGAyDtYixBv12
value 6820000
address 1FUeYDth9ZiayiJTSnQswuK6bZ34Sk6w69